David Bowie was a visionary artist whose career redefined the boundaries of popular music and performance. Emerging from London’s vibrant scene in the late 1960s, he became known for his ever-evolving style, from the glam-rock persona of Ziggy Stardust to the experimental sounds of the Berlin Trilogy. Blending rock, art, and theater, Bowie influenced generations with his fearless creativity and constant reinvention. His legacy endures through timeless hits, groundbreaking visuals, and an enduring spirit of innovation that continues to inspire artists worldwide.
